31st Regulation for the Implementation of the Federal Immission Control Act (BImSchV).

Abstract
This regulation aims to limit the emissions of volatile organic compounds (VOCs) from certain industrial facilities that use organic solvents in their processes. The regulation sets out general and specific requirements for limiting emissions, including the use of best available techniques (BAT) and the development of reduction plans. The regulation also requires the reporting of emissions data and the implementation of monitoring and control measures. The regulation includes transitional provisions for existing facilities, with different deadlines for compliance depending on the type of facility and activity. The text also includes definitions of key terms, such as emission control equipment and solvent consumption. The text consists of 13 Articles and 7 Annexes.
